TOGETHER SPOKANE: A proposal to improve schools, parks and neighborhoods.
Spokane Public Schools and Spokane Parks and Recreation are proposing a historic initiative to re-build schools, renovate and add parks and create programming for kids and adults. Every neighborhood, every park and every school has a proposed project.

Costumes for Halloween and Skate Night. We are inviting students to wear costumes to Skate Night on 10/30 and on 10/31 for "Book Character Day". Please help your student pick a costume that is school appropriate for both events. Costumes should not include a mask, makeup, weapons, and should not be scary or depict violence. We are looking forward to celebrating this season with the students and we appreciate your help in ensuring costumes are fun and fitting for the school setting.
